电子说
在电子设计领域,一款功能强大且集成度高的芯片往往能为产品开发带来诸多便利。AT8xC51SND1C就是这样一款值得关注的单芯片闪存微控制器,它集成了MP3解码器和丰富的人机接口功能,为各类音频及多媒体应用提供了理想的解决方案。
AT8xC51SND1C系列包含AT89C51SND1C、AT83SND1C和AT80C51SND1C三款芯片。它们是完全集成的独立硬连线MPEG I/II-Layer 3解码器,采用C51微控制器核心来处理数据流和MP3播放器控制。其中,AT89C51SND1C拥有64K字节的闪存内存,并可通过嵌入式4K字节的引导闪存内存进行系统内编程;AT83SND1C包含64K字节的ROM内存;而AT80C51SND1C则没有代码内存。三款芯片均配备2304字节的RAM内存。
可实现可编程音频输出,与常见的音频DAC接口兼容,支持PCM格式和I²S格式,借助片上PLL,几乎能连接市场上所有的商用音频DAC系列。
基于8位MCU C51核心(FMAX = 20 MHz),拥有2304字节的内部RAM和64K字节的代码内存(AT89C51SND1C为闪存,AT83SND1C为ROM,AT80C51SND1C无代码内存),还具备4K字节的引导闪存内存(仅AT89C51SND1C),支持通过USB(标准)或UART(可选)进行下载。
AT8xC51SND1C的应用场景十分广泛,常见于MP3播放器、PDA、相机、手机、汽车音频/多媒体以及家庭音频/多媒体等领域。它能为这些设备提供高质量的音频解码和丰富的接口功能,提升产品的性能和用户体验。
芯片提供TQFP80、BGA81、PLCC84(开发板)等多种封装形式,还有裸片可选,方便不同的设计需求。
文档详细介绍了各种信号的功能和特性,包括端口信号(如P0 - P5)、时钟信号(X1、X2、FILT)、定时器信号(INT0、INT1、T0、T1)、音频接口信号(DCLK、DOUT、DSEL、SCLK)、USB信号(D+、D-)等。不同的信号在芯片的正常运行和与外部设备的交互中发挥着重要作用。
内部时钟由片上PLL从片上振荡器提取,为C51核心、MP3解码器、音频接口和其他外设分别生成时钟。C51和外设时钟源自振荡器时钟,MP3解码器时钟通过PLL输出时钟分频得到,音频接口采样率也通过PLL输出时钟分频获得。
实现了五个8位端口(P0 - P4)和一个4位端口(P5),除了通用I/O功能外,部分端口还支持外部数据内存操作和替代功能,所有I/O端口均为双向。
具备两个通用的16位定时器/计数器,可独立配置为定时器或事件计数器,在达到预设时间或计数次数时发出中断请求。
硬件看门狗定时器可在芯片超时运行时自动复位,确保系统在软件或硬件故障时能恢复正常。
还包括MP3解码器、音频输出接口、通用串行总线接口、多媒体卡接口、IDE/ATAPI接口、串行I/O接口、串行外设接口、2线控制器、A/D控制器和键盘接口等,这些外设共同构成了芯片丰富的功能体系。
存储温度范围为 -65°C至 +150°C,任何引脚相对于VSS的电压范围为 -0.3V至 +4.0V,每个I/O引脚的IOL为5 mA,功耗为1W。需要注意的是,超出绝对最大额定值可能会导致芯片永久性损坏。
详细给出了数字逻辑、A/D转换器、振荡器与晶体、锁相环、USB连接、MMC控制器和系统内编程等方面的直流特性参数,如输入输出电压、电流、电阻、电容等。
对外部程序总线周期、外部数据8位总线周期、外部IDE 16位总线周期、SPI接口、TWI接口、MMC接口、音频接口、模拟到数字转换器和闪存内存等的交流特性进行了说明,包括各种信号的时序定义和波形图。
文档提供了不同型号芯片的订购信息,包括部件编号、内存大小、电源电压、温度范围、最大频率、封装形式、包装方式和产品标记等,方便用户根据需求进行选择。
AT8xC51SND1C以其强大的MP3解码功能、丰富的外设接口和良好的电气特性,为电子工程师在音频及多媒体产品设计中提供了一个可靠的解决方案。在实际应用中,工程师们可以根据具体需求充分发挥芯片的优势,开发出更具竞争力的产品。你在使用这款芯片的过程中遇到过哪些问题呢?欢迎在评论区分享交流。
全部0条评论
快来发表一下你的评论吧 !